Acting Quote by Uta Hagen
“Talent is an amalgam of high sensitivity; easy vulnerability; high sensory equipment (seeing, hearing, touching, smelling, tasting intensely); a vivid imagination as well as a grip on reality; the desire to communicate one's own experience and sensations, to make one's self heard and seen.”
About This Quote
Source Book: Respect for Acting by Uta Hagen, 1973
Talent blends heightened perception, emotional openness, vivid imagination, and a grounding in reality, driven by a need to share personal experience.
In simple terms: Talent is keen senses, openness, imagination, and a desire to be heard.
